Yakuza Kiwami 3: The rebirth of a legend

In this chapter, players continue the journey of former yakuza Kazuma Kiryu as he fights to protect those he cares about. Yakuza Kiwami 3 is an extreme remake of the original Yakuza 3, delivering a complete overhaul in visuals, gameplay, and content.

The bustling streets of Okinawa and Tokyo are rendered in stunning detail thanks to modern graphics technology. The combat system has been rebuilt, pushing the franchise’s signature street brawls to a new level of brutality and fluidity. New cutscenes deepen the narrative, while enhanced side experiences expand the open-world immersion.

Dark Ties: A new perspective on Yoshitaka Mine

Included in this bundle is Dark Ties, a standalone storyline that explores the previously untold past of Yoshitaka Mine. Once the head of a successful startup company, Yoshitaka Mine willingly descended into the yakuza underworld after losing everything.

His journey is a search for genuine connections to fill the emptiness in his heart. Unlike Kazuma Kiryu’s fighting style, Dark Ties introduces boxing-based combat, promising a fresh experience for longtime series fans.

Two destinies, one point of convergence

Although they walk different paths, the destinies of these two men eventually converge and shake the foundations of fate itself. Integrating both storylines gives players a deeper, multi-layered view of the world and events of Yakuza.
